Key Insights
The Africa Data Center Networking market is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ach a substantial market size by 2033. A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 13.40% from 2025 to 2033 indicates a significant expansion driven by several key factors. The increasing adoption of cloud computing and digital transformation initiatives across various sectors, including IT & Telecommunications, BFSI (Banking, Financial Services, and Insurance), Government, and Media & Entertainment, is fueling demand for advanced networking infrastructure within data centers. Furthermore, the rising need for enhanced data security and reliable connectivity is driving investments in sophisticated networking solutions. The market is segmented by end-user, component (product and services), and specific networking equipment. Key players like Radware, F5 Networks, Dell EMC, Cisco, and Juniper Networks are actively competing in this dynamic landscape, offering a range of solutions tailored to the specific needs of African businesses and governments. The expansion of 5G networks and the growing adoption of edge computing technologies further contribute to the market's positive outlook. While challenges such as infrastructural limitations and economic volatility exist, the long-term growth prospects remain strong, particularly in rapidly developing economies within the region. Strategic partnerships, technological innovation, and investments in skilled workforce development will be critical for sustained market expansion. Countries like South Africa, Kenya, and Uganda represent significant market opportunities due to their relatively advanced digital infrastructure and economic activity.
Growth within the African Data Center Networking market will likely be uneven across countries, mirroring the varying stages of digital transformation across the continent. The "Rest of Africa" segment, encompassing numerous nations with developing digital infrastructure, represents a substantial untapped market with significant future potential. As these nations continue to prioritize digitalization efforts, demand for data center networking solutions will rise, presenting opportunities for both established and emerging players. The market's competitive landscape is characterized by both international technology giants and regional players, resulting in a dynamic mix of solutions and pricing strategies. This competitive environment is expected to further encourage innovation and drive down costs, making data center networking solutions more accessible across the African continent. The focus on cloud-based solutions and software-defined networking (SDN) will likely continue to be a significant driver of market expansion, offering greater flexibility and scalability for businesses operating in Africa.

8. Can you provide examples of recent developments in the market?
July 2023: Moxa introduced its MDS-G4020-L3-4XGS series of Ethernet switches, a highly versatile line of Layer 3 full Gigabit modular managed switches. This series offers support for four 10GbE ports and sixteen Gigabit ports, including four embedded ports. Furthermore, it includes four interface module expansion slots and two power module slots, ensuring the utmost flexibility for a wide range of applications.
